    • Another almost gothic detective novel by James Lee Burke
    • I picked this up in an airport shop. It seemed particularly fitting reading for a trip to New Orleans. The protagonist, Dave Robicheaux and his unique friends continue to grow on me with each additional novel in this series.

Book Description

For detective Dave Robicheaux, memories -- including those of a strange and violent summer from his youth -- are best left alone. But a dying man's confession forces Robicheaux to resurrect a decades-old mystery with a missing woman at its heart. Her name may or may not have been Ida Durbin, and Robicheaux's half brother, Jimmie, paid a brutal price for entering her world. Now the truth will plunge Robicheaux into the manipulations of New Orleans' wealthiest family, into a complex love affair of his own, and into hot pursuit of a killer expanding his territory beyond the Big Easy at a frightening pace.
